The people at XM are as bad as the music they play. Perhaps they "pipe in" their music which in turn puts them in an altered state. I asked if they are going to grant a discount (I have 3 other cars on Sirius) since they have merged the two company's. The all but told me to pi-- off.
So, I called our local car stereo store and as luck would have it, they had 1 SIR GM unit left. I headed over after I hung up, paid slightly too much, and was out in 40 minutes.
They located the Sirius antenna in the channel on the left side of my coupes back glass, in clear site with the glass open, out of site with it closed.
Now the best part, the quality of the Bose system
has improved so much it's as though I replaced the entire stereo. I actually had to back off the bass because of the improved quality. I am convinced that my disappointment with the Bose system can be primarily attributed to the unacceptable tinny XM sound.I could not be more pleased with this "mod" if any of you have been on the fence on this do it, you will have no regrets.
